Job Overview :
The Technical Service Assistant supports the Service Department by managing product returns, performing assessments and repairs, and ensuring returned units are accurately processed and restored when appropriate. This position also serves as a first point of contact for inbound calls from customers, dealers, representatives, and service technicians, addressing technical questions, parts requests, and general inquiries. In addition, the role may provide cross-departmental support, including production and shipping, to meet business needs.
Key Responsibilities :
- Receive, check in, and catalog all returned products.
- Inspect and refurbish returned units to restore them to sellable condition.
- Perform evaluations and repairs for units submitted under warranty.
- Answer, document, and resolve inbound calls regarding technical support, parts, and general service inquiries.
- Collaborate with other departments to support production, shipping, and service needs.
- Utilize software tools to track, report, and manage service activities (experience with Microsoft Outlook, Excel, Word a plus)
- Perform additional duties as assigned.
